Sen. Mitch McConnell released a negative campaign ad Wednesday attacking his GOP primary opponent, Matt Bevin — even though the primary contest is not until May 2014.
The ad hits Bevin for accepting $200,000 in “taxpayer bailouts” — a grant awarded to Bevin’s companies by Connecticut Gov. Dannel Malloy after a fire destroyed the building that housed the companies, according to a Hartford Courant article cited in McConnell’s ad.
